5110110023 has 8 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 5176987200. Its totient is φ = 5043287808.
The previous prime is 5110110007. The next prime is 5110110043. The reversal of 5110110023 is 3200110115.
It is a sphenic number, since it is the product of 3 distinct primes.
It is a cyclic number.
It is not a de Polignac number, because 5110110023 - 24 = 5110110007 is a prime.
It is a super-2 number, since 2×51101100232 = 52226448894330121058, which contains 22 as substring.
It is a Duffinian number.
It is a congruent number.
It is not an unprimeable number, because it can be changed into a prime (5110110043) by changing a digit.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 7 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 193715 + ... + 218507.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(647123400).
Almost surely, 25110110023 is an apocalyptic number.
5110110023 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(66877177).
5110110023 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.
5110110023 is an odious number, because the sum of its binary digits is odd.
The sum of its prime factors is 27481.
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 30, while the sum is 14.
The square root of 5110110023 is about 71485.0335594801. The cubic root of 5110110023 is about 1722.4372810048.
Adding to 5110110023 its reverse (3200110115), we get a palindrome (8310220138).
